@anyone else

And really, Kid Icarus is really the only series that is having a true revival. It was 18 years since the last Kid Icarus game (Gameboy). And the only stirrings the series has seen in those 18 years were emulated rereleases on GBA and Wii VC. Uprising is completely new and a total revival. Starfox, though its recent history has been shaky, has received its fair share of games in the past few years. There were two Gamecube games and a DS one. So it never really died, though it is in need of a rekindling thanks to quality control issues and such. And Paper Mario of course never died. It was on N64, Gamecube, and Wii.
